About 8 Roundtown

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

8 Roundtown is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Aynho, Banbury, Banbury (OX17 3BG). It has a recorded floor area of 161 m² (around 1730 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(September 2011) shows an E (score 48),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The latest certificate is from September 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a basement and a loft.

2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. The record references listed-building consent, which constrain future alterations. Across 1996–2013,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£541,000 is 42.4% above the 2013 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£220/sq ft) was about 24.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On the market in September 2013 and unlisted since — roughly 13 years.

  1. Sept 2014
    ExtensionHeritage
    Outcome in report

    Extension: Single storey · Rear of property

    Single storey rear extension to existing garage. Re roof in slate to match existing sloped roof and addition of 1 No. roof light. Removal of existing chimney breast in the kitchen and external stack and remove existing loft area to expose the vaulted roof timbers and re point exposed high level stone with lime mortar. Replace existing roof light on the second floor to match internal opening size. Extend ground floor W.C using adjacent cupboard to create a shower room. Re instate original opening to sitting room from hall and replace the panelling in the sitting room with real wood panelling. Strip back and re plaster using lime mortars to make good previous maintenance repairs. Extend width of existing low wall and fence by 1.8m to allow for a wider and safer access to the rear driveway.
